Filly in the Box -Don’t Go Alone | Dubstep

Attention: mild spoilers, nothing obvious though.

Back once again with impeccable sound design, Filly in the box has a new track inspired by the latest episode of MLP. The drum samples and programming (and even some of the melodies) reminds me a lot of the early mainstream dubstep that came about at the end of the 00s, whilst the bass sounds used sound very much modern – an interesting juxtaposition of sounds that works incredibly well!

Dr. Somepony – Equs Infernus | Metal

In perfect Dr. Somepony style of rocking the music scene with a sutble emotional side that makes the difference, here’s a new track that definitely hits home with a deep theme, dealing with the aftermath of Celestia’s hard feelings as she had to banish her sister to the moon, and the musical composition and performance to back it up, including awe-inspiring keyboard notes and hard-hitting melodic guitar riffs.

FlyingMelodys – Family Forever More | Soft Rock

A pleasant instrumental piece from FlyingMelodys, this song is actually a rework of one of their older pieces. It combines soft rock, acoustic, and orchestral elements into one single track dedicated to the CMC.
